Innocent until proven guilty? In Japanese criminal trials, about 95% of the defendants are found guilty. In the United States, about 60% of the defendants are found guilty in criminal trials. (Source: The Book of Risks, by Larry Laudan, John Wiley and Sons) Suppose you are a news reporter following five criminal trials. (For each answer, enter a number.) (a) If the trials were in Japan, what is the probability that all the defendants would be found guilty? (Round your answer to three decimal places.)

(b) What is this probability if the trials were in the United States? (Round your answer to three decimal places.)

(c) Of the five trials, what is the expected number of guilty verdicts in Japan? (Round your answer to two decimal places.)

(d) What is the expected number in the United Sates? (Round your answer to two decimal places.)

(e) What is the standard deviation in Japan? (Round your answer to two decimal places.)

(f) What is the standard deviation in the United States? (Round your answer to two decimal places.)
